Step 4: Planting the Bulbs

Planting bulbs correctly is crucial for their growth and flowering.

  1. Dig holes or trenches according to the depth recommended for each bulb type.
  2. Place the bulbs in the holes with the pointed end facing upwards.
  3. Cover with soil and water thoroughly to encourage growth.

Best Practices

Implement these best practices for optimal results in your flower garden.

  1. Rotate planting locations each year to prevent soil depletion.
  2. Pair bulbs with complementary plants for a visually appealing display.
  3. Mulch around bulbs to retain moisture and regulate soil temperature.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Address these common issues to maintain a thriving flower garden.

  1. If bulbs fail to bloom, check for proper planting depth and soil conditions.
  2. Monitor for pests and diseases that may affect bulb health.
  3. If blooms are sparse, consider additional fertilization or adjusting watering schedules.
